Re: [easybuild] caffe/mxnet/tensorflow easyconfigs
Hi We used EB for all the dependencies (Python, Swig, PCRE, Bazel) when building a GPU-enabled TF 0.9.0 on our Cray systems. Building TF itself required a couple of ugly tweaks (see [1]), I was not convinced that it would work so I didn’t bother to create the .eb for that. So far the users didn’t complain much about this build, so I assume it is working. You can find the .eb files we used for Python, Swig, PCRE and Bazel on [2]. I hope it helps. -- Cheers, G.
